The Autorité de Régulation des TIC de Côte d'Ivoire has reaffirmed its commitment to promoting an inclusive digital economy following a high-level meeting with the country’s Minister of Digital Transition and Technological Innovation, Djibril Ouattara.

The delegation, led by Director General Lakoun Ouattara, was received by Mr. Ouattara to discuss key priorities for the development of Côte d’Ivoire’s digital sector.

During the meeting, officials commended Fleur Régina Bessou, Technical Advisor to the Director General, on her election as Chair of the International Telecommunication Union’s Telecommunication Development Advisory Group (TDAG), as well as her recent Leadership Award from the Observatory for the Promotion of Good Governance.

Discussions also focused on advancing digital inclusion and strengthening women’s leadership within the technology sector, areas identified as critical to the country’s digital transformation agenda.

ARTCI noted that the engagement reflects ongoing efforts to build a dynamic, inclusive and forward-looking digital economy in Côte d’Ivoire.
